2015 Septa Design Challenge

This DESIGNchallenge was sponsored by the Center for Design + Innovation at Temple University’s Fox School of Business. This event was also partner with Philadelphia’s SEPTA. The challenge was held at the Kimmel Center’s Hamilton Garden on. There were over 140 students that register for this challenge from different school to work on creating a innovative idea within the theme of “Mass Transit, Car culture & Philadelphia’s Quality of Life.” At this event every person was randomize to sit at different group and to come up with the most innovative idea for the usage of public transportation.
